Fox & Hounds
Fountain Hill Rd, Walkeringham, DoncasterAs the last surviving pub in Walkeringham, it attracts a good range of people across all ages. What makes this place great is that it ‘DOESN’T’ serve food, which means it concentrates on being a social environment. Great for making new friends, watching the football (only pub within a 8 mile radius to have football on) and also does a great job of having food vendors and music artists on once per fortnight on a Friday.
The landlord and lady, Keli and Rai always make you feel welcome and it’s a safe space for those who want to venture in alone and make new friends. Highly recommended.
